From: Shan Wei @ 2011-04-20  1:31 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: mirq-linux, David Miller, netdev
Fix the below compile warning:
drivers/net/forcedeth.c:4266: warning: ‘nv_set_tso’ defined but not used
commit 569e146 converts forcedeth driver to use hw_features.
So, implement function of .set_tso is abandoned.
Signed-off-by: Shan Wei <shanwei@cn.fujitsu.com>
---
 drivers/net/forcedeth.c |   10 ----------
 1 files changed, 0 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/net/forcedeth.c b/drivers/net/forcedeth.c
index ec9a32d..0e1c76a 100644
--- a/drivers/net/forcedeth.c
+++ b/drivers/net/forcedeth.c
@@ -4263,16 +4263,6 @@ static int nv_nway_reset(struct net_device *dev)
 	return ret;
 }
 
-static int nv_set_tso(struct net_device *dev, u32 value)
-{
-	struct fe_priv *np = netdev_priv(dev);
-
-	if ((np->driver_data & DEV_HAS_CHECKSUM))
-		return ethtool_op_set_tso(dev, value);
-	else
-		return -EOPNOTSUPP;
-}
-
 static void nv_get_ringparam(struct net_device *dev, struct ethtool_ringparam* ring)
 {
 	struct fe_priv *np = netdev_priv(dev);
-- 
1.6.3.3
